Description
This procurement process is being advertised and run by First Greater Western Limited on its own behalf and on behalf of the successor operator of the rail passenger transport services in respect of Great Western Railway. That successor operator will be a public sector company, is expected to be a wholly owned subsidiary of DfT OLR Holdings Limited and will be ultimately owned by the Secretary of State for Transport. The date for transfer of the current operations to the successor operator is not yet confirmed. Where the transfer is completed before contract award under this procurement process, the successor operator may elect (but will not be obliged) to carry on with this procurement process in place of First Greater Western Limited, by taking on the role of contracting entity from the date of completion of the transfer (with this notice and all other procurement documents to be interpreted accordingly). Where the transfer is not yet completed by the time of contract award, contractual rights may be included in the contractual arrangements to enable transfer to the successor operator. Bidders should note that this procurement process (if ongoing), or any awarded contract, may be included in a transfer scheme made by the Secretary of State under section 12 of the Railways Act 2005, or the transfer may be effected outside of, or separate from, such a scheme.
Framework Overview:
Great Western Railway (GWR) is seeking to establish a multi-supplier, multi-lot Framework Agreement for the provision of Transport and Distribution Services, including Courier and Heavy Haulage Services (the "Framework"). The Framework is intended to provide GWR with a flexible and efficient mechanism for procuring such services throughout the Framework Term across GWR's network.
The framework will be split into three Lots:
Lot 1 - Courier and Freight Distribution Services
Lot 2 - Transport and Distribution of Large or Heavy Traction and Rolling Stock Components (GVW ≤ 44 tonnes)
Lot 3 - Heavy Haulage and Abnormal Indivisible Load Transport
No guarantee is given as to the volume, frequency or value of Services to be procured under the Framework. Appointment to the Framework does not confer any exclusivity, minimum spend, minimum volume, minimum order, capacity reservation or other commitment and shall not oblige GWR to award any Call-Off Contract to any Framework Supplier.
